      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thanks for that info Blencogo.  I'm sorry I didn't see the other thread on this, but am I correct in saying there is no Search option on this Forum?&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;I checked the connectors inside the box and noticed the front connectors are wired to the Avermedia card on which the rear connectors are also.&lt;BR /&gt;So I thought maybe it doesn't like both connected?&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;I have my Sky box connected to the rear composite connectors so I tried removing those, and Click2DVD still didn't see the analog VCR signal from the front connectors.&lt;BR /&gt;I tried connecting the VCR to the rear composite connectors (which I know work) and Click2DVD still did not recognise the analog VCR signal.&lt;BR /&gt;So I suspect Click2DVD is the issue on the XL201.  I didn't bother re-installing it at this stage.&lt;BR /&gt;I then decided to try this in MCE itself.&lt;BR /&gt;I reconnected my Sky Box to the rear composite connectors and reconnected the VCR to the front composite connectors.&lt;BR /&gt;I then did the 'setup TV signal' in MCE, and selected Satellite.&lt;BR /&gt;It then scanned the inputs and found Sky on Composite 1 and displayed the live TV in the little window.&lt;BR /&gt;However, I then move the cursor to Composite 2 and selected that, and hey, it showed the VCR picture.&lt;BR /&gt;So I selected this, and went through the guide settings even though I wasn't using them.&lt;BR /&gt;Then when you select 'Live TV' in MCE, it plays the VCR picture.&lt;BR /&gt;You can then press the Record button on your remote and create an MCE manual recording and give it a suitable name.&lt;BR /&gt;I will use MCE to put this on a DVD, or I may just leave it on the HDD.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;After doing this, I will have to reset the TV input in MCE to see Sky, but that is a 2 minute job.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;So don't bother with Click2DVD,  use MCE.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Andy&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
